Soldiers of Prince Roman the Great 14th Mechanized Brigade destroyed the Russian Buk-M1-2 SAM system’s 9A310M1-2 TELAR in the east.
Volunteer and blogger Serhii Sternenko published a video of the enemy’s defeat.
According to him, the 9A310M1-2 transporter erector launcher and radar (TELAR) of the Buk-M1-2 SAM was destroyed by a powerful Ukrainian FPV drone.
The Russians deployed a launcher with two green anti-aircraft missiles among the trees in a forestry area between fields on the temporarily occupied territory.
Ukrainian defenders discovered the Russian air defense position and attacked it with a kamikaze drone. The explosion of its warhead caused the launcher to catch fire.
However, it is unknown how many FPVs were used to defeat the Russian Buk-M1-2 SAM system’s 9A310M1-2 TELAR.
The footage captures the flames seriously damaging the launcher from the inside and destroying the missiles.
The volunteer added that the visual inspection, as well as radio intercepts and radar monitoring data in the area of the Buk-M1-2 SAM launcher, confirmed the destruction of the Russian SAM.
Earlier on Tuesday, March 12, the Ukrainian Defense Forces reported the destruction of another Buk SAM in one of the sections of the Ukrainian-Russian front.
The video of the Special Operations Forces Command indicates that a high-precision munition was used to destroy the Russian equipment, and it is likely that the Russian system was hit by a US HIMARS rocket system.
The footage shows that after the ammunition hit, the anti-aircraft missiles detonated and burned violently. This caused several missiles to fly in different directions.
The powerful fire and detonation of ammunition indicate the destruction of the Russian system.
